Taxonomic Classification

Rank Campbell's Maple Grass
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Sapindales (Sapindales) Poales (Grasses)
Family Sapindaceae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Acer Eriochloa
Species Acer campbellii Eriochloa procera

Evolutionary Relationship

Campbell's Maple and Grass share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)
